Notes. The regions used are shown in Fig. 11, explained in Sect. 7.2. The galaxies with (bulge) and without (no bulge) a separately fitted bulge component are shown separately. The parameters are stellar velocity dispersion (σ) [km s−1], mass (“m”) and light (“l”) weighted stellar ages [Gyrs], and metallicity in respect to solar metallicity (log10Z/Z). The (g′-r′) and (r′-i′) colors obtained from the SDSS mosaic images are also shown. The uncertainties are calculated from the sample standard deviation, divided by square-root of sample size. One of the galaxies did not have an i′-band image.
